Electric AIR Pump Relay (5.7L)
- Start engine. With engine operating in open loop, electric air pump should run and air should be coming out of electric air pump exhaust port.
- If electric air pump is operating, allow engine to idle for at least 3 minutes. With vehicle in closed loop (or about 3 minutes after start), PCM should de-energize electric air pump relay and electric air pump should stop. If air pump does not operate as described, go to next step. If air pump operates as described, relay is functioning properly.
- Remove air pump relay from fuse/relay block. Air pump should stop. If air pump stops, check or replace faulty relay. If air pump does not stop, check circuit to air pump for a short to battery voltage.
